What are Morbid hosts?

Morbid is a true crime podcast hosted by Alaina Urquhart and Ash Kelley. They are known for their engaging storytelling and in-depth research into crime cases, both famous and obscure. The hosts are aunt and niece, and they bring a mix of professionalism, humor, and empathy to their discussions, making the show appealing to a wide audience. Morbid covers not only murders but also other strange and spooky topics, creating a unique listening experience for true crime fans.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a mortician,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Mortician, you need a solid understanding of embalming, restorative techniques, and funeral service practices, usually supported by a degree in mortuary science and state licensure. Familiarity with mortuary management software, embalming equipment, and compliance with health and safety regulations is essential. Compassion, professionalism, and strong communication skills are crucial for supporting grieving families and managing sensitive situations. These skills ensure respectful care of the deceased, legal compliance, and the provision of comfort and guidance to clients during difficult times.

What are some morbid jobs?

Morbid jobs typically involve working with death, injury, or the macabre, such as funeral directors, morticians, forensic investigators, and crime scene cleaners. These roles often require emotional resilience, specialized training, and adherence to health and safety protocols. They are essential in industries related to death care, forensic science, and disaster response.

Company Description

Founded in 2003 and headquartered in Norfolk, Virginia, IPConfigure. Inc. is a privately held veteran owned video surveillance research and development software company. As a developer of IP video surveillance solutions, IPConfigure offers a variety of products - all of which leverage a browser-based interface while supporting both Windows and Linux architectures and are capable of seamlessly supporting unlimited cameras, locations, and users in a centralized, distributed, or hosted architecture.  IPConfigure's Orchid VMS platform and SteelFin Appliances have been successfully deployed in facilities ranging from quick service restaurants to international ports, hospitals, and universities.
